Difference in the color stability of direct and indirect resin composites

ABSTRACT
Indirect resin composites are generally regarded to have better color stability than direct resin composites since they possess higher conversion degree.

OBJECTIVE:

The present study aimed at comparing the changes in color (ΔE) and color coordinates (ΔL, Δa and Δb) of one direct (Estelite Sigma 16 shades) and 2 indirect resin composites (BelleGlass NG 16 shades; Sinfony 26 shades) after thermocycling. MATERIAL AND

METHODS:

Resins were packed into a mold and light cured; post-curing was performed on indirect resins. Changes in color and color coordinates of 1-mm-thick specimens were determined after 5,000 cycles of thermocycling on a spectrophotometer.

RESULTS:

ΔE values were in the range of 0.3 to 1.2 units for direct resins, and 0.3 to 1.5 units for indirect resins, which were clinically acceptable (ΔE<3.3). Based on t-test, ΔE values were not signifcantly different by the type of resins (p>0.05), while ΔL, Δa and Δb values were signifcantly different by the type of resins (p<0.05). For indirect resins, ΔE values were infuenced by the brand, shade group and shade designation based on three-way ANOVA (p<0.05).

CONCLUSION:

Direct and indirect resin composites showed similar color stability after 5,000 cycles of thermocycling; however, their changes in the color coordinates were different.
